Aida Khorsandi


About

Aida began her musical studies as a young child. She was a member of Pars Children’s Choir that performed at famous music venues in Tehran, Iran since the 1990s. Pars Choir has sung in different languages and musical genres such as Jazz, Classical, Folk and Iranian orchestral music. Aida studied music performance (B.A.) at Tehran University of Art with Piano as her main instrument and flute as her second instrument. In addition, she took opera singing lessons for many years during and after her studies at university. After graduation from University of Art, Aida worked as a piano teacher.

Education

Pursuing her interest in teaching and learning. Aida completed a course and an internship in early childhood music education in Pars Music Institute, the most reputable children’s music institute in Iran. She then continued her journey in music and human cognition through studying cognitive science of music at University of Jyvaskyla, Finland. She obtained a master’s degree (M.A.) in music psychology research with a focus on affective science of music. Aida has an Orff Pedagogy Level I Certificate from The Royal Conservatory of Music, Toronto, Canada.
